SPRINGFIELD, Mass. - The Western New England men's tennis team opened play in The Commonwealth Coast Conference (TCCC) with an 8-1 victory over previously unbeaten Wentworth Institute of Technology Saturday afternoon (Mar. 26).
This was the fifth consecutive victory for the Western New England who raised its record to 5-2. The Leopards fall to 2-1 overall with the same mark in conference play.
Coach Jenn Kolins' squad captured all three doubles matches with senior co-captains Brian Relihan (Orange, CT) and Mike Jones (Stone Ridge, NY) taking their number one doubles flight with an 8-3 victory.
Sophomore Chris Holzinger (Foster, RI) and junior JonPaul Ouellette (Bethlehem, CT) teamed for an 8-3 win at number two doubles. Senior Matt Minahan (Plymouth, MA) and junior Shawn Fitzpatrick (Burnt Hills, NY) combined for an 8-5 decision at the number three spot.
In singles play, Jones (6-1, 6-0), Holzinger (6-2, 6-0), Ouellette (6-2, 6-2), and Minahan (6-1, 6-3) each captured their number two through five matches, respectively, in straight sets.
Senior Tim Santye (Skillman, NJ) had the closest outing rallying for a 4-6, 6-3 (10-7) victory at number two singles.
Wentworth's only point came at number one singles with sophomore Juan Rodriquez (Quito, Ecuador) posting a 6-1, 6-1 victory.
Before the match, there was a moment of silence for former Golden Bears' standout Chris Blaine who died last week at the age of 30.
"As a former captain and assistant coach, Chris has left a legacy with our program," said Kolins. "He would be proud of the high standard of excellence that the men on this year's team hold and they certainly represent his memory well. Chris will always be in our hearts."
A formal memorial service for Blaine will be held at a later date.
